Many influencers and brands have been struggling with engagements on social media. What advice would you give to increase the engagement rate?
Olga: Share your story and learn to share it in a way that people would want to come back to your page to check on you. That’s how you get loyal followers and more engagement. No one has a story you have. Also, keep in mind that everything you share on your page makes an impact on other people. So make sure you do it right.
Natalia: I guess that the most important is to be consistent and post according to your schedule. For example, I am posting every day no matter what. Because I know that there are followers who are waiting for my posts. Also, I would recommend posting something that your followers don’t expect you to. We all are getting bored sometimes and need something new. For example, if you are posting your daily outfits all the time, try to post brunch spots or makeup routine, just to diversify your feed.

How do you think social media has transformed the travel and fashion business?
Olga: I think it transformed it big time. Every time before I book a hotel or experience, I make sure to check out their social media accounts to make sure I’m going to like that place and it has positive reviews.
Natalia: I think that with the social media era fashion transformed more into fast fashion. Because every day now we are looking for something new. As for travel business, social media became the key factor in developing new destinations and places. Travel bloggers and influencers create amazing content, that is the best PR for any destination. Just take a look at how popular and overcrowded is Bali or Positano now with the help of influencers.
